What This Workflow Does

This automation bridges the gap between your Airtable database and Telegram messaging, creating an instant notification system for your team. Whenever a new record is added to your specified Airtable base, the workflow automatically sends a customized Telegram message to your chosen channel or group.

For businesses using Airtable as a CRM, project management tool, or operations tracker, this solution eliminates the need for manual notifications. Team members receive mobile alerts in real-time, ensuring they never miss important updates while away from their computers.

How It Works

1. New Record Detection

The workflow constantly monitors your Airtable base for new records using Make.com's Airtable module. It can watch specific tables and even filter for certain record types if needed.

2. Data Extraction

When a new record is detected, the automation extracts relevant fields you specify - this could be customer names, project details, task assignments, or any other important information from your Airtable structure.

3. Message Formatting

The workflow then formats this data into a Telegram-friendly message. You can customize the template to include emojis, field labels, and even conditional formatting based on record values.

4. Telegram Delivery

Finally, the formatted message is sent to your pre-configured Telegram channel or group. The automation handles all the API connections behind the scenes.

What You'll Need

  1. An Airtable account with a base containing the data you want to monitor
  2. A Telegram account with admin access to the channel/group where messages should be sent
  3. A Make.com account (free plan available)
  4. Basic familiarity with Airtable field structure

Quick Setup Guide

  1. Copy this template to your Make.com account
  2. Connect your Airtable account and select the base/table to monitor
  3. Set up your Telegram bot (template includes instructions)
  4. Customize the message template with your preferred fields and formatting
  5. Test with a new Airtable record to verify delivery
  6. Schedule the workflow to run continuously
